ডেটাবেস সিলেক্ট

SELECT Statement টি ব্যাবহার করে ডেটাবেস থেকে ডেটা সিলেক্ট করা যায়।যেমন নিচের উদাহরনটি persons table এর সমস্ত ডেটা সিলেক্ট করবে
01.<?php
02.$con = mysql_connect("localhost","rej","abc123");
03.if (!$con)
04.{
05.die('Could not connect: ' . mysql_error());
06.}
07. 
08.mysql_select_db("my_db", $con);
09. 
10.$result = mysql_query("SELECT * FROM Persons");
11. 
12.while($row = mysql_fetch_array($result))
13.{
14.echo $row['FirstName'] . " " . $row['LastName'];
15.echo "<br />";
16.}
17. 
18.mysql_close($con);
19.?>
উপরের উদাহরনে mysql_query() function যে ডেটা ফেরৎ পাঠালো তা $result variable সংরক্সিত হয়ে থাকে।

 

আউটপুট

Rejoan Alam
Riad Ahmed
Umme Salma

আউটপুট HTML table এ দেখানো

নিচের কোডটি উপরের মতই একই ডেটা সিলেক্ট করবে কিন্তু আউটপুট টেবিলে দেখাবে
01.<?php
02.$con = mysql_connect("localhost","rej","abc123");
03.if (!$con)
04.{
05.die('Could not connect: ' . mysql_error());
06.}
07. 
08.mysql_select_db("my_db", $con);
09. 
10.$result = mysql_query("SELECT * FROM Persons");
11. 
12.echo "<table border='1'>
13.<tr>
14.<th>Firstname</th>
15.<th>Lastname</th>
16.</tr>";
17. 
18.while($row = mysql_fetch_array($result))
19.{
20.echo "<tr>";
21.echo "<td>" . $row['FirstName'] . "</td>";
22.echo "<td>" . $row['LastName'] . "</td>";
23.echo "</tr>";
24.}
25.echo "</table>";
26. 
27.mysql_close($con);
28.?>

আউটপুট

Firstname Lastname
Huzaifa Alam
Ahmed karim
UmmeSalma
mysqli ব্যবহার করে ডেটা সিলেক্ট করা
01.<?php
02.$con =new mysqli("localhost","root","","book_sc");
03.if (!$con)
04.{
05.die('Could not connect: ' . mysqli_connect_error());
06.}
07. 
08.$result = $con->query("SELECT * FROM books");
09.echo "<table  border='1'><tr>
10.<th>ISBN</th>
11.<th>Author</th>
12.<th>Title</th>
13.<th>Category ID</th>
14.<th>Price</th>
15.<th>Description</th>
16.</tr>";
17.while($row = $result->fetch_array())
18.{
19.echo"<tr>";
20.echo "<td>" .$row['isbn']."</td>";
21.echo "<td>" .$row['author']."</td>";
22.echo "<td>" .$row['title']."</td>";
23.echo "<td>" .$row['catid']. "</td>";
24.echo "<td>" .$row['price']. "</td>";
25.echo "<td>" .$row['description']. "</td>";
26.echo"</tr>";
27.}
28.echo"</table>";
29.?>
আউটপুট:
ISBN Author Title Category ID Price Description
0672329166 Luke Welling and Laura Thomson PHP and MySQL Web Development 1 49.99 PHP & MySQL Web Development teaches the reader to develop dynamic, ....
067232976X Julie Meloni Sams Teach Yourself PHP, MySQL and Apache All-in-One 1 34.99 Using a straightforward, step-by-step approach, each ...

কোন মন্তব্য নেই

Blogger দ্বারা পরিচালিত.